    Pasquotank County says real estate and personal property tax bills are mailed in July and due September 1, with payment through January 5 without interest. Interest begins January 6 at 2% for the first month and an additional 0.75% each month thereafter. The county accepts cash, personal checks, and online credit/debit card payments through Official Payments with jurisdiction code 4399 and additional fees.
